Giorgio Armani is to open the first home furnishing store in the UAE at the end of October, the Italian fashion designer said on Monday.
Armani said it will open an Armani/Casa store at Dubai Mall under a partnership with Emaar Retail, a subsidiary of Dubai developer Emaar Properties.
It said the store will be ready for when Dubai Mall opens its doors to the public, scheduled for Oct. 30.
The store will include furniture, accessories, fabrics, ornaments and lighting all designed by Giorgio Armani, in addition to offering interior design services.
Giorgio Armani said in a statement Dubai Mall was “a prestigious location” for its flagship Armani/Casa store in the UAE.
The Dubai Mall will have over 1,200 retail stores and over 160 food and beverage outlets when it opens.
Macy's Inc announced last week that the first Bloomingdale's store outside the US will open at Dubai Mall in February 2010.
Bloomingdale's will have two locations at the mall, a three-level fashion and accessories store and a one-level home store.
Giorgio Armani is also launching an Armani hotel and Armani-designed residences in the Burj Dubai, the world’s tallest building, located next to Dubai Mall.
